Hi people,

I'm attempting to customize the heading text on pages, specifically the login page (langcust01).

I'm using the edit language function in admin, and although i have changed the default text it doesn't appear to be applying the changes. And before you say it yes i am obviously pressing the update record button.

Any idea whats going wrong?

The other thing is the font size of these headings, they are rather large, including the text on the search page, any idea how to change that?

make sure you press the "reset language" link/button after making the changes; then they should magically appear.

if you don't do that then they don't seem to take effect regardless of what you do with the actual data.

everytime you edit the languague you will need to refresh your database, there should be a reset button, that will refresh the database

the font size should be in shop$colors.asp page

Just a little advice for future regarding refreshing the database, i have recently discovered that the 'reset language' button on the occasional tasks frontend works every time and more effeciently, rather than the reset button within the edit language window.

This was a large cause of my problems as i was making changes and they didn't appear to be updating, using the 'reset language' button rather than the 'reset' button however works everytime, i havent had to clear my IE7 cache since.
